How much do full time cx strategist j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 28, 2026, the average yearly pay for full time cx strategist in the United States is $139,867.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$121,500.00 and $157,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Full Time Cx Strategist vs Customer Experience Analyst?

AspectFull Time Cx StrategistCustomer Experience Analyst
Primary RoleDevelops and implements customer experience strategies to improve satisfaction and loyaltyAnalyzes customer data to identify trends and insights for CX improvements
Required SkillsStrategic thinking, project management, customer journey mappingData analysis, reporting, customer feedback interpretation
Work EnvironmentCollaborates with cross-functional teams, often in a strategic planning capacityFocuses on data collection and analysis, often within analytics or research teams

The Full Time Cx Strategist focuses on creating and executing comprehensive customer experience strategies, while the Customer Experience Analyst primarily analyzes data to inform CX improvements. Both roles require understanding customer needs, but the strategist emphasizes planning and implementation, whereas the analyst emphasizes data insights. They often work together to enhance overall customer satisfaction.

The Role

As an Experience Strategist in Kyndryl Vital, you will shape the go-to-market strategy and create high-impact pre-sales content that fuels Customer Experience (CX) pipeline growth. You will translate market needs and human-centered approaches into compelling offerings, narratives, and solution frameworks that empower sellers, differentiate Kyndryl in the market, and win deals.

This role blends strategic thinking, customer empathy, and storytelling excellence to influence buying decisions and accelerate revenue.

You will be responsible for:

  • Creating Compelling Pre-Sales Content: Develop reusable assets, pitch materials, value propositions, compelling POVs, storytelling frameworks, and executive-ready narratives that clearly articulate customer outcomes and business impact.
  • Business + Tech + Experience: You will create integrated experience strategies that blend business, technology, and user needs, advocating for a customer-first approach to ensure all experiences are intuitive and meet user needs.
  • Design and deliver solutions: You will create strategic deliverables such as experience maps, user journeys, and service blueprints to articulate insights and guide solution development.

Required Skills and Experience

  • Business Acumen: You understand business strategy and can connect it to experience and help others understand the value of experience-led outcomes

  • Experience Optimization: You can evaluate and recommend ways to optimize customer and employee experiences, including moments that could be improved with self-serve, AI, automation, and empowerment across the end-to-end journey

  • Design and deliver solutions: Create strategic deliverables such as experience maps, user journeys, and service blueprints to articulate insights and guide solution development.

  • Co-Creation: You excel at aligning stakeholders through workshops and collaborative sessions. You've facilitated brainstorming / future-state innovation sessions and use case development that foster experimentation and POCs/prototypes.

  • Storytelling: You can build a compelling narrative and communicate clearly - rooted in a desire to change mind, hearts and behaviors

  • Conduct Research and Analysis: You can design and conduct qualitative and quantitative research, concept evaluations, and competitive analyses - identifying trends, opportunities, and potential threats to inform the future state CX vision.

  • Psychology: You have a deep understanding of human needs and behavior (e.g. thoughts, expectations, motivations, perceptions, beliefs, emotions, etc.) to influence desirability, adoption, and culture.

What you'll need:

  • 5+ years in progressive, CX strategy focused consulting role; with a blend of sales and delivery experience preferred, bringing cross-industry perspectives and outside-in thinking/best practices.

  • Undergraduate or graduate degree in service design, strategic design, innovation strategy,business administration, or a related field.

  • Ability to travel up to 30% as business requires.

The compensation range for the position in the U.S. is -
$88,680 to $168,480based on a full-time schedule.

Your actual compensation may vary depending on your geography, job-related skills and experience. For part time roles, the compensation will be adjusted appropriately. The pay or salary range will not be below any applicable state, city or local minimum wage requirement.

There is a different applicable compensation range for the following work locations:

California (San Francisco Bay Area): $106,440 to $202,200

California (All Other): $97,560 to $185,280

Colorado:$88,680 to $168,480

Massachusetts: $88,680 to $185,280

New York City:$106,440 to $202,200

Washington:$97,560 to $185,280

Washington DC:$97,560 to $185,280
